Definition

PO Approval Monitoring is the continuous oversight and evaluation of a Purchase Order (PO) as it progresses through the approval lifecycle. It ensures that approvals are completed on time, follow defined policies, and comply with the organization’s procurement approval matrix, providing real-time visibility and control over procurement activities.

How PO Approval Monitoring Works

PO Approval Monitoring involves tracking approval activities, identifying delays, and ensuring that each step in the approval process adheres to governance standards.

  • Real-time monitoring: Tracks approval progress as it happens

  • Exception detection: Identifies delays, bottlenecks, or policy deviations

  • Approval validation: Ensures each step complies with authorization rules

  • Integration with multi-level approval workflow: Monitors progression across all approval levels

  • Alert mechanisms: Notifies stakeholders of pending or overdue approvals

This ensures that procurement processes remain efficient, transparent, and compliant.

Practical Business Scenario

A large enterprise manages hundreds of POs daily. Through PO Approval Monitoring, the procurement team observes:

  • Several POs delayed at finance approval for over 48 hours

  • High-value POs requiring escalation due to missed approvals

  • Recurring delays in specific departments

Outcome:

  • Alerts are triggered for overdue approvals

  • Approval bottlenecks are identified and resolved

  • Procurement timelines improve significantly

This proactive monitoring enhances Purchase Order Accuracy and supports reliable cash flow forecasting.

Best Practices for Effective Monitoring

Organizations can optimize PO Approval Monitoring by adopting structured and proactive practices.

  • Implement real-time dashboards: Provide instant visibility into approval status

  • Set clear monitoring thresholds: Define acceptable approval timelines

  • Enable automated alerts: Notify stakeholders of delays

  • Integrate with compliance frameworks: Ensure governance alignment

  • Continuously review performance: Identify and resolve bottlenecks

These practices ensure that monitoring remains effective, scalable, and aligned with organizational objectives.
